Some things we didn't know before freedom of information:
the hazards of gravestones - Tens of thousands of headstones have been flattened or removed across the country because of fears that they could fall on gravediggers or members of the public
what happens to lazy police officers - Cheshire force has not sacked any officer for incapability in the last decade - from which the LibDems conclude 'police forces are failing to sack lazy and incompetent officers'
But we still don't know what alternatives to the M20 have been considered as the sites of lorry parks when the Channel Tunnel is shut, because it could lead to 'unnecessary public concern caused by premature disclosure especially as such sites have been discounted.'
